Full and rich Pinot - not classically light Italian style, but ripe and fun. Has held beautifully over the years and will still drink great for several more. Spendy, but delicious.

Clean fruit nose, with nothing overt towards oak. 'color of Alto Adige reds.'. Med + aroma intensity, nebbiolo style attack in the tannins. Intense Italian structure. Floral. Black tea. Really really fun, but for $80, please, work on the label.

11/9/2011 - Ben Christiansen wrote:
Structured, intense Pinot Noir. Maybe needs more time? Seems way over priced to me at $80.
